During the Cold War, the US covertly funded and armed Afghan mujahideen through Operation Cyclone to resist the Soviet invasion, often working via Pakistan’s ISI. While some fighters later joined groups hostile to the US, historians emphasize this as unintended blowback, not a deliberate strategy to create terrorism. Hillary Clinton has acknowledged the consequences of these policies but never claimed the US intentionally created terrorist organizations.
